**Step-by-Step Solution:** 1. **Identify the Question**: The question asks about the association of uricose glands with specific types of glands. 2. **Understand Uricose Glands**: Uricose glands are specialized glands found in certain male reproductive systems. They are involved in the storage and release of uric acid. 3. **Recognize the Options**: The options given are collateral glands, mushroom glands, congobate glands, and vasodifferentiate. 4. **Connect Uricose Glands with Mushroom Glands**: Uricose glands are specifically associated with mushroom-shaped glands in the male reproductive system. 5. **Function of Uricose Glands**: These glands store uric acid, which is released during copulation, specifically over the spermatophore. 6. **Eliminate Incorrect Options**: - Collateral glands: Not related to uricose glands. - Congobate glands: Not related to uricose glands. - Vasodifferentiate: Not related to uricose glands. 7. **Conclude the Correct Answer**: Based on the association of uricose glands with mushroom-shaped glands, the correct answer is option number 2: mushroom glands. ---
